This week's comic comes from Malaka Gharib, the Washington, D.C.-based founder of The Runcible Spoon, one of our favorite super-indie food zines. Here, she lays out everything you need for an ideal Egyptian breakfast, a choose-your-own adventure of sending kids to the store and mixing and matching your favorite components.
